Course Introduction

Electrical Plant Shutdown Management Training Course is designed to provide participants with comprehensive knowledge and practical skills for planning, coordinating, executing, monitoring, and evaluating electrical plant shutdowns in industrial facilities. The course focuses on minimizing operational risks, ensuring electrical safety, optimizing maintenance activities, reducing downtime, controlling project costs, and achieving successful plant restart while complying with international standards, industry regulations, and organizational best practices.

Planned electrical shutdowns are critical events that provide opportunities to perform major maintenance, equipment upgrades, inspections, testing, and reliability improvements that cannot be completed during normal plant operations. This course equips participants with the technical competence required to manage every phase of an electrical shutdown, from initial planning and scheduling through execution, commissioning, startup, and post-shutdown performance evaluation, ensuring that shutdown objectives are achieved safely and efficiently.

Participants will gain practical knowledge of shutdown planning, work scope development, maintenance scheduling, critical path analysis, resource allocation, electrical isolation, permit-to-work systems, lockout/tagout procedures, contractor management, quality assurance, equipment testing, commissioning, risk assessment, contingency planning, and shutdown performance measurement. Practical case studies and real-world industrial examples enable participants to confidently manage complex electrical shutdown projects across a wide range of industrial sectors.

Course Outline

Module 1: Fundamentals of Electrical Plant Shutdown Management

  • Principles of electrical plant shutdown planning and operational coordination

  • Types of planned shutdowns, turnarounds, and maintenance outage strategies

  • International standards and regulatory requirements governing shutdown activities

  • Roles and responsibilities of shutdown management teams and stakeholders

Module 2: Shutdown Planning and Scheduling

  • Developing detailed shutdown scopes and maintenance work packages effectively

  • Preparing shutdown schedules using critical path and resource optimization methods

  • Budget estimation, procurement planning, and spare parts management strategies

  • Establishing shutdown milestones and project performance measurement systems

Module 3: Risk Assessment and Safety Management

  • Conducting comprehensive shutdown risk assessments and hazard identification processes

  • Implementing permit-to-work systems and electrical isolation procedures safely

  • Applying lockout/tagout practices to protect maintenance personnel effectively

  • Managing emergency response and contingency planning during shutdown operations

Module 4: Maintenance Execution and Coordination

  • Coordinating electrical maintenance teams and contractor work activities efficiently

  • Managing inspections, testing, repairs, replacements, and equipment upgrades

  • Monitoring shutdown progress through effective communication and reporting systems

  • Controlling work quality and minimizing schedule deviations during execution

Module 5: Electrical Equipment Testing and Commissioning

  • Testing transformers, switchgear, motors, generators, and protection systems thoroughly

  • Verifying equipment performance before plant startup and energization safely

  • Conducting commissioning procedures following maintenance completion successfully

  • Preparing electrical systems for safe return to operational service

Module 6: Asset Management and Reliability Improvement

  • Integrating shutdown activities with asset lifecycle management strategies effectively

  • Applying reliability-centered maintenance principles during planned shutdowns

  • Evaluating equipment condition to support long-term maintenance planning decisions

  • Optimizing maintenance investments for improved operational reliability and availability

Module 7: Digital Shutdown Management Technologies

  • Utilizing CMMS and Enterprise Asset Management systems during shutdown projects

  • Applying Industrial Internet of Things technologies for equipment condition monitoring

  • Using digital dashboards to monitor shutdown progress and project performance

  • Managing documentation through cloud-based shutdown management platforms

Module 8: Emerging Technologies and Innovation

  • Artificial intelligence supporting shutdown planning and maintenance optimization

  • Digital twins improving shutdown simulation and maintenance decision-making processes

  • Robotics and drone-assisted inspections enhancing shutdown safety and efficiency

  • Cybersecurity considerations for digitally connected industrial shutdown operations

Module 9: Performance Evaluation and Continuous Improvement

  • Measuring shutdown performance using key operational performance indicators

  • Conducting post-shutdown reviews and lessons learned workshops systematically

  • Identifying opportunities for improving future shutdown planning and execution

  • Developing corrective and preventive action plans based on project outcomes

Module 10: Best Practices in Shutdown Management

  • Establishing world-class electrical shutdown management frameworks and procedures

  • Auditing shutdown processes to ensure compliance and operational excellence

  • Building effective stakeholder communication throughout shutdown project lifecycles

  • Implementing continuous improvement strategies supporting reliable plant operations
